Abstract

The invention provides a seed coating which can control root rot of soy beans and a preparation method thereof. The seed coating comprises a disinfectant and an accessory ingredient which can control root rot of soy beans. The material components are as follows: dimethomorph thiram, hymexazol, a film forming agent, a thickening agent, a warn color, foam killer and water which are prepared according to the following steps in turn: the original drugs of the thickening agent, the dimethomorph, the thiram and the hymexazol are added into proper amount of water, ground and stirred for 1.5 to 2 hours and fully mixed; then the film forming agent and the warn color are added and fully stirred and mixed for 1 to 2 hours; finally the foam killer is added for killing foams; and a finished product isobtained if the detection is qualified. The seed coating does not have harmful effects on the emergence of seedlings and growing of the beans, can control the Phytophthora root rot of the soy beans and the fusarium root rot of the soy beans; the control effect of the seed coating is between 80.2 and 85.7 percent; moreover, the seed coating does not have harmful effects to the growing of the soya beans and can remarkably improve the yield of the soy beans.

Description

technical field

[0001] The invention belongs to the technical field of crop disease prevention and control, and more specifically relates to a seed coating agent for preventing and treating soybean root rot and a preparation method thereof. Background technique

[0002] Soybean root rot is an important disease in soybean production, which occurs in various production areas of my country. It was reported for the first time in Ohio, U.S. by Suhovecky et al. in 1955. Since then, various countries have reported the serious occurrence of root rot (Ma Huiquan et al., 1988). The main feature of this disease is that it is widely distributed, and the mode of transmission mainly depends on soil-borne and seed-borne transmission. Examples

Embodiment 1

[0034] The composition of embodiment 1 seed coating (by weight percentage)

[0035] 8% dimethomorph, 18% thiram, 5% hymexazol, 6% film former (by weight: the ratio of polyvinyl alcohol 1788, sodium benzoate and water: 5:1:3), 1% Thickener (bentonite), 0.5% warning colorant (basic rhodamine), 0.2% defoamer (tributyl phosphate) and the rest are water, making up 100%.

Embodiment 2

[0036] The composition of embodiment 2 seed coatings (by weight percentage)

[0037] 10% dimethomorph, 15% thiram, 8% hymexazol, 8% film former (by weight: the ratio of polyvinyl alcohol 1788, sodium benzoate and water: 5:1:3), 2% Thickener (bentonite), 0.3% warning colorant (water-based rose red), 0.2% defoamer (tributyl phosphate) and the rest are water, making up 100%.

Embodiment 3

[0038] The composition of embodiment 3 seed coatings (by weight percentage)

[0039] 10% dimethomorph, 20% thiram, 6% hymexazol, 4% film former (by weight: the ratio of polyvinyl alcohol 1788, sodium benzoate and water: 5:1:3), 0.5% Thickener (bentonite), 0.2% warning colorant (bright red pigment), 0.1% (tributyl phosphate) and the rest are water, making up 100%.
